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company Ltd. (TSM), the world’s largest dedicated semiconductor foundry, is trading at $363.35 as of 2026-04-16, marking a 3.13% decline in recent sessions. This analysis covers key technical levels, prevailing sector context, and potential near-term price scenarios for the stock, amid ongoing volatility in the global semiconductor space.
